February 2, 2013

Picnic-Perfect Piazza in Rome

Piazza Garibaldi in Rome, Italy

Piazza Garibaldi is situated on a hilltop on the western side of Rome's city center. It's a scenic and lovely walk through tree-lined streets with kooky sculptures and children's jungle gyms up to the gorgeous view. A perfect place for a picnic!

No comments:

Post a Comment